Presentation
Warwick's Framus Phosphore Bronze .053 is aimed at acoustic guitarists looking for a very solid tonal base and a strong presence in the lower register.
The round phosphor-bronze purfling provides ample projection and a strong attack. The hexagonal core stabilises tension and maintains an even response, even under high dynamics.
With a total length of 1000 mm and a strung length of 950 mm, this string is ideal for standard acoustic guitars. This string develops a firm, powerful feel, ideal for heavy accompaniment and intense rhythmic playing.
